How to Turn Company Documents into Training Content with NotebookLM, Gamma and Canva AI

Most internal training fails because the knowledge already exists, but it lives in dense documents nobody wants to read.

Before and after

Before: A manager copied policy text into slides, added generic visuals, and delivered a training session that felt like a document with a microphone.

After: NotebookLM can extract the useful structure, Gamma can create a first training deck, and Canva can polish the visual layer.

Best AI tools for this workflow

  • NotebookLM
  • Gamma
  • Canva AI
  • ChatGPT

Step-by-step workflow

  1. Step 1: Collect only approved source documents.
  2. Step 2: Use NotebookLM to identify the key concepts and misunderstood areas.
  3. Step 3: Ask ChatGPT to create learner scenarios and quiz questions.
  4. Step 4: Draft the training deck in Gamma.
  5. Step 5: Polish visuals and handouts in Canva AI.

What I would check before paying

Training content should change behavior. Add scenarios, decisions, and checks, not just summaries.

Conclusion

AI makes internal training faster, but the human job is choosing what people must actually remember and do.
